croup (croup) (kr[ldbomac]p) a condition resulting from acute partial obstruction of the upper airway, seen mainly in infants and children; characteristics include resonant barking cough, hoarseness, and persistent stridor. It may be caused by a viral infection (usually a parainfluenzavirus), a bacterial infection (usually Staphylococcus aureus, Streptococcus pneumoniae, or Streptococcus pyogenes), an allergy, a foreign body, or new growth.
